About
Overview
An Art Deco masterpiece in the heart of downtown, the Hotel Phillips is a popular choice with guests who appreciate the charm and character of a grand and historic hotel. The hotel's address was once occupied by a haberdashery operated by President Harry S. Truman and his brother. Today, the hotel's top floor suite is named in his honor. Built in the 1930's, this 20-story luxury hotel, a national landmark, continues to exude all the elegance of the period with modern amenities. Many of the original details remain, including the walnut paneling, intricate metalwork, 20-story mail chute, Art Deco light fixtures and a gilded winged statue of the goddess Dawn.
